62770039 has 2 divisors, whose sum is σ = 62770040. Its totient is φ = 62770038.

The previous prime is 62770021. The next prime is 62770111. The reversal of 62770039 is 93007726.

It is a weak prime.

It is a cyclic number.

It is not a de Polignac number, because 62770039 - 27 = 62769911 is a prime.

It is a junction number, because it is equal to n+sod(n) for n = 62769986 and 62770013.

It is a congruent number.

It is not a weakly prime, because it can be changed into another prime (62770339) by changing a digit.

It is a pernicious number, because its binary representation contains a prime number (19) of ones.

It is a polite number, since it can be written as a sum of consecutive naturals, namely, 31385019 + 31385020.

It is an arithmetic number, because the mean of its divisors is an integer number (31385020).

Almost surely, 262770039 is an apocalyptic number.

62770039 is a deficient number, since it is larger than the sum of its proper divisors (1).

62770039 is an equidigital number, since it uses as much as digits as its factorization.

62770039 is an odious number, because the sum of its binary digits is odd.

The product of its (nonzero) digits is 15876, while the sum is 34.

The square root of 62770039 is about 7922.7545083765. The cubic root of 62770039 is about 397.4209887393.
